Arizona Cardinals
Two stories coming out of Arizona camp. The team reportedly offered CJ2K a contract after 3rd round pick David Johnson injured his hamstring. Chris Johnson is reportedly hesitant to sign, saying he wants to make sure he can make the team before signing.

Pittsburgh Steelers
The team signed kicker Garrett Hartley after learning starter Shaun Suisham tore his ACL. Hartley played in only a couple games with the Browns in 2014 and hasn’t held a consistent starting job since 2013 with the Saints. In that season Hartley had a 73.3% FG%, while Suisham completed over 90% of his field goals.
